Have you ever wondered what happened between the Old and New Testaments once Matthew 1 starts? David Asscherick explores this 400-year gap, revealing the political, social, and spiritual landscape that shaped Jesus’ arrival. See how Matthew presents Him as the fulfillment of God’s promises, and understand why His message of a kingdom unlike any earthly empire was so radical. You’ll grasp the revolutionary nature of Christ’s reign and its relevance today.
